Abstract
During the operation of spacecraft control system in orbit, a large amount of telemetry data will be generated. These data can characterize the operation performance of spacecraft control system and have high analytical value, which can identify the health status and operation performance of spacecraft from the telemetry in orbit. This paper presents a cluster storage system and an autonomous health assessment system. Simulation analysis and practical application show that the system supports the efficient storage of more than 800 spacecraft telemetry data, realizes the data elimination of 99.3% accuracy, realizes the fault self-diagnosis of 98.7% accuracy, can complete a comprehensive health assessment of the spacecraft in 3.5 seconds, and automatically generates the evaluation report.
